Backfilling services involve filling in gaps or voids in soil or other materials around a property’s foundation, landscaping, or other structures. This process typically follows excavation work, such as installing new utilities, repair projects, or landscaping upgrades. The goal is to restore stability and support to the affected area, ensuring that the ground remains level and secure. Skilled service providers use specialized equipment and techniques to carefully place and compact fill material, preventing future settling or shifting that could cause damage or uneven surfaces.

This service helps solve common problems like foundation settling, uneven ground, or drainage issues caused by soil erosion. When a property experiences shifting or sinking of the ground near the foundation, it can lead to cracks, uneven floors, or other structural concerns. Backfilling can also address problems caused by water pooling or poor drainage, which may undermine the stability of walkways, driveways, or retaining walls. Proper backfilling ensures that soil compaction is adequate, reducing the risk of future problems and maintaining the integrity of the property.

Properties that often require backfilling services include residential homes, particularly those with basements or crawl spaces, as well as commercial buildings with underground utilities or excavation work. Landscaped yards that have undergone grading or soil replacement also benefit from backfilling to stabilize slopes and prevent erosion. Additionally, new construction projects, such as patios, retaining walls, or foundation installations, typically need backfilling to support the structure and ensure long-term stability. The overview below groups typical Backfilling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Alpharetta, GA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or backfilling jobs in Alpharetta range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, covering tasks like filling small holes or leveling uneven ground.

Partial Backfills - for larger sections or partial backfill projects,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common for yard restorations or small excavation backfills.

Full Backfill Projects - complete backfilling for larger areas or significant excavations can range from $1,500 to $3,500, with some complex projects exceeding this range depending on scope and materials used.

Full Replacement - when an entire area requires complete removal and new backfill, costs typically start at $3,500 and can go beyond $5,000+ for extensive, high-complexity projects in Alpharetta and nearby areas.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
